A leading intralogistics company in the UK seeks a Field Service Engineer to join their customer service engineering team. The role involves visiting various client sites for servicing, repairs, and preventative maintenance on material handling equipment and forklift trucks.
Ideal candidates should have a strong background in mechanical and electrical engineering, along with previous customer service experience. A full driving license is necessary.
The position offers competitive benefits including extensive training and a comprehensive toolkit.
